CI note — Parcelhawk webhook suite failing on merge.

The mock courier replay in stage 2 times out if the fixture cache is cold. Re-run the job once before digging in. If it fails twice, the signature stub in the Droverline harness is stale. Reference the build token printed below when filing.

pipeline stamp: htk31_f769b577b3028a4e9958e5bb8d1259a

## Restarting the FieldHerd Gateway

When telemetry from Harrowvale tractors stalls, first confirm the uplink daemon is running before cycling the gateway. A full restart drops buffered sensor frames, so drain the queue with the flush command and wait for the green state. New team members: never restart during an active harvest window without paging the duty lead. After the service comes back, verify the firmware matches the token below.

trace token, fafog-kageg: htk4_98e6

Runbook: CSV Import Wizard (Gridfall platform). If a plugin's column-mapping hook times out, the wizard silently falls back to auto-mapping — check the import log first, not the UI. Timeouts, row limits, and encoding fallbacks are all set server-side. Plugin authors should test against the values below.

deployment values, yadup-kadug:
[sorys]
port = 5672
team = noveth
host = sorys.orvexcorp.example
region = south-4
access_code = ac_deddc1
timeout_ms = 1500

**Vendor note: GPU memory profiling tooling**

We have licensed Heliotrace Insight from Varnholt Systems for GPU memory profiling on the Emberline training cluster. Reviewers should note the agent injects hooks at allocator level, so any PR touching `cuda_alloc_shim.cc` must be re-validated against the vendor's compatibility matrix. The license covers 40 concurrent sessions; do not embed the agent in CI images. For contract or quota questions, write to our vendor liaison at the address below.

alerts address for bajop-yahog: istwyn@lumiclabs.internal

Ticket: Staging env misconfigured for Siftgate bloom filter

The bloom layer in front of the Pellet KV store is rejecting all lookups in staging because the env file was copied from the dev template without credentials. False-positive tuning values are fine; only the auth line is missing. To unblock the weekly demo, the Pellet admission secret must be set on the following line.

env line for yaguf-fajop: LEDGER_TOKEN13=fb08984397349